US ZIP Code 22044 Population by Race & Ethnicity
| Race / Ethnicity | Population | Percentage |
|---|---|---|
| White (Non-Hispanic) | 6,146 | 43.9% |
| Hispanic or Latino | 4,100 | 29.3% |
| Asian | 2,028 | 14.5% |
| Black / African American | 923 | 6.6% |
| Two or More Races | 676 | 4.8% |
| Other Race | 118 | 0.8% |
| Native American | 5 | 0.0% |
| Pacific Islander | 0 | 0.0% |
